Exclamation 18-135 or 17-85mm Lens for Canon T3i?

Hey Members.

I have a Canon T3i and the standard 18-50mm lens which is damaged, I also have a fixed 50mm 1.8 lens.

After looking around online for reviews etc the most recommended lenses for the T3i seemed to be 18-135mm and 17-85mm with the later getting better reviews.

I need a good all aorund lens for taking mostly car pics and some travel pics. But Mostly car shots. It shouldnt cost an arm and a leg either. If you had a choice of one of the above lenses which one would you choose and recommend.Thanks Guys.

I used to have the 18-135mm IS lens. It was great for car shows because it always focused correctly, it was light, it had a huge range, and it's clarity was good.

I gave that to a friend when I got my EF-S 17-55mm f/2.8 IS USM and my EF 70-200mm f/4L IS USM lenses. The 17-55 is doesn't focus as consistently but otherwise I haven't looked back. Unfortunately you get what you pay for with Canon lenses. That being said, the 18-135 is excellent value for money.
